> I'm sure there's an easy answer to this question.  How do I 
> locate/activate my parallel port?  I'm running FC3 on an Intel 845-based 
> motherboard.
>  
> /$ dmesg | grep par/
>  
> turns up nothing.
>  
> /$ cat /proc/ioports/
>  
> turns up nothing looking like a parallel port, either.  The 378 
> neighborhood seems vacant.
>  
> Is there a set of packages that I need to install?
> 

what does

     modprobe -k parport_pc

say? If it doesn't show up in Linux, it might be disabled
in your BIOS?! More than the kernelmodule parport_pc is AFAIK
not needed.
